By: Wheezybz https://foodal.com/knowledge/how-to/soften-brown-sugar/#comment-20189 Wed, 12 Oct 2016 00:57:12 +0000 https://foodal.com/?p=28619#comment-20189 How exactly does the microwave soften the sugar? The heat evaporates water doesn’t it so wouldn’t it harden even more? Of course, I can’t try it because my microwave doesn’t seem to have power settings.
